The Robert Waters Economic Development Fund has warded the Community Foundation for the Alleghenies with a gift of $2.5 million to support community and economic development in Cambria, Somerset and Bedford counties.
The Waters fund is managed by a committee of regional finance and economic development professionals and it is designed to make loans, investments and limited grants to appropriate projects and initiatives, including start-ups and expansions, equity investments and loan guarantees.
